A lovely big beach - one of our favourites. In the summer, dogs are only allowed at the Black Rock end of the beach. Surf school and good cafe. The council carpark is cheaper for short stays.

Our favourite beach when the tide is out as you can walk for miles, but unfortunately less beach available when the tide is in! Also check out the natural Sea Pool. There is a surf school and the RNLI lifeboat, a shop, cafe and beach huts for hire.

Pretty village with shops, pubs, cafes and harbour. Cliff walks. National Trust shop with information about the flood in 2004 that devastated most of the village.

Tintagel village and castle are associated with the legends of King Arthur and the Knights of the Round Table. Nice place to visit with lots of places to eat.
